Yvette, does that mean if we click on the "ignore" button the person's posts won't show up or they simply won't be able to contact us specifically??
Posted by admin on Oct 13, 2007 · Member since Apr 2003 · 167 posts
If you click the ignore button next to a post, the screen will refresh, the post will still be there, but it then will say "This user is currently ignored." instead of the content of the post. There will also be a show button to show just that post and an unignore button to un-do the ignore.
In regards to "simply won't be able to contact us specifically", that has been a long standing option in your VegFriends "My Profile and Settings" under "Personal Message Options".
